Output 6362622cb2359919f794e03ead5b7583e00f3be2038af9e2e9c72d6c5e7b9c7a:0
- value
- 586347032
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6f79676a3916d90e4d697e0afd199b2685ed1f0 OP_EQUAL
- address
- 3MHf8HzURCQmrqjHiM4GhEhGmHRCbFTjgk
- transaction
- 6362622cb2359919f794e03ead5b7583e00f3be2038af9e2e9c72d6c5e7b9c7a
- confirmations
- 375413
- spent
- true